Transaction 75ef07963ab41fad49bb33a02405371b5dbcffa010b47a80d2c0c87b4b231c7f

1 Input
2 Outputs
  • 75ef07963ab41fad49bb33a02405371b5dbcffa010b47a80d2c0c87b4b231c7f:0
  • value  2505740
    address  3QGH9d9tehR7kUT4WH8FiL5YeNfngyndRW
  • 75ef07963ab41fad49bb33a02405371b5dbcffa010b47a80d2c0c87b4b231c7f:1
  • value  7743919
    address  3NLoswXkfyBBne84RU8u8WZUSPsXHhCtPr